Schritte zur Fehlerbehebung bei allgemeinen Problemen
- Überprüfen des API-Schlüssels::
- Überprüfen Sie, ob die Schlüsseldatei (~/.config/openrouter/key.txt) existiert und ob ihr Inhalt korrekt ist
- Überprüfen Sie, ob der Schlüssel gültig und in der OpenRouter-Plattform frei ist
- Überprüfung der Netzwerkverbindung::
- Prüfung (Maschinen usw.)emigo-base-urlOb die konfigurierte API-Adresse erreichbar ist
- Überprüfen Sie, ob die Proxy-Einstellungen des Systems den Emacs-Netzwerkzugriff beeinträchtigen
- Statusrückmeldung bearbeiten::
- Sicherstellen, dass die Emigo-Hintergrundprozesse ordnungsgemäß ausgeführt werden
- Versuchen Sie einen Neustart von Emacs und einen Neustart von Emigo
- Ansicht des Fehlerprotokolls::
- Emacs' *Messages*-Puffer für Fehlermeldungen anzeigen
- Prüfen Sie im Verzeichnis ~/.emacs.d/emigo, ob Protokolldateien erzeugt wurden
Fortgeschrittene Lösungen
- Versuche, die schrittweise Erledigung komplexer Aufgaben zu reduzieren
- Vorübergehender Wechsel der Modelle, um modellspezifische Probleme zu testen
- Reichen Sie das Problem ein und machen Sie es auf der GitHub-Projektseite verfügbar:
- Emacs-Version
- Python-Version
- Detaillierte Reproduktionsschritte
- Auszüge aus dem Fehlerprotokoll
Anmerkungen zur Veröffentlichung
Emigo befindet sich derzeit in der Beta-Phase und kann noch instabil sein. Es wird empfohlen, den Status von Emigo regelmäßig über dieGit-PullAktualisieren Sie auf die neueste Version.
Diese Antwort stammt aus dem ArtikelEmigo: ein Assistent für komplexe Programmieraufgaben mit KI in EmacsDie































